Description

Homemade strawberry cream cheese dip blends sweet and tangy flavors for an irresistible appetizer. Creamy Philadelphia cream cheese mingles with fresh strawberries, creating a smooth spread perfect for parties and gatherings. You will crave this simple yet elegant treat.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ups (360 ml) frozen whole strawberries
  • 1 package (8 oz / 226 g) cream cheese
  • 2 tbsps (30 ml) granulated sugar
  • ¼ cup (60 ml) fresh basil, thinly sliced
  • 1 tbsp (15 ml) balsamic vinegar

Instructions

  1. Strawberry Preparation: Combine frozen strawberries, granulated sugar, and balsamic vinegar in a mixing bowl, allowing natural defrosting for 45 minutes at room temperature to develop deep, rich flavors.
  2. Texture Creation: Crush strawberries using a fork or potato masher, maintaining a rustic, chunky consistency that preserves the fruit’s natural character and textural complexity.
  3. Cream Cheese Presentation: Artfully position the entire cream cheese block on a serving platter, creating a smooth, inviting canvas for the strawberry topping.
  4. Flavor Fusion: Cascade the macerated strawberry mixture over the cream cheese, ensuring an even distribution that allows the vibrant crimson sauce to enhance the creamy base.
  5. Herbal Accent: Adorn the dip with delicately sliced fresh basil ribbons, introducing a sophisticated herbal dimension that elevates the overall sensory experience.
  6. Serving Suggestion: Pair with an elegant selection of crisp crackers or golden-brown pita chips, providing the perfect vehicle for enjoying this luscious dip.
  7. Storage Guidance: Preserve any remaining portions in an airtight container within the refrigerator, maintaining optimal flavor and freshness for 2-3 days.
